Output a85683126fdea320189a51c5af72de9311871d3fba92fddac534461e81a10c5e:1

value
1902558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ca726f3624139b50f5b7e749865a691cb047868 OP_EQUAL
address
37DihzJ5mgR8mQzKRs62EdEu45iq3duNMD
transaction
a85683126fdea320189a51c5af72de9311871d3fba92fddac534461e81a10c5e
spent
true